Mahapajapati Monastery is a meditation monastery for women dedicated to living the Buddha’s teachings. We are a monastic and contemplative community in the Theravada Buddhist tradition, and as such, we value both solitude and social harmony. We invite you to share in our simple, quiet life of practice and study.

The monastery is in Pioneertown, California, on eighty acres of high desert in the southern part of the state. Founded in 2007 by Therese Duchesne, Mahapajapati Monastery was under the guidance of Ayya Gunasari as invited abbess until 2020, and Ayya Ñāņadīpa since 2023.
